Severe Weather Potential South

Look for big tornadoes with a lot of damage and even some deaths on the late news Saturday. A strong area of low pressure will be moving across the lower Ohio Valley beginning tomorrow. Severe weather will move ahead of the front. Here in southeast Indiana, I don't anticipate any severe weather, but there may be some gusty winds and brief heavy downpours. Earlier in the week, up to two inches of rain was forecast for the weekend, but I just don't see that happening. Once this storm moves out of the area by Tuesday, much cooler air will filter in behind and highs will likely be back into the low 50's (11C). This will only last for a day though and by the weekend of May 1, temperatures may be close to 80F (27C) As always though, time will tell.
